摘要
随着高校规模的不断扩大和学生数量的持续增加,传统手工管理宿舍的方式已难以满足现代化管理的需求。宿舍管理涉及学生信息、住宿分配、费用缴纳、维修申请等多个环节,数据量大且流程复杂,容易出现信息滞后、效率低下等问题。因此,开发一套高效、智能的宿舍管理系统具有重要的现实意义。该系统能够实现宿舍资源的合理分配、学生信息的动态更新、日常事务的自动化处理,有效提升管理效率和服务质量。关键词:宿舍管理、高校信息化、自动化、MySQL8.0、SpringBoot2。
本系统基于SpringBoot2框架搭建后端服务,结合Vue3实现前端交互,采用MyBatis-Plus简化数据库操作,MySQL8.0作为数据存储引擎,确保系统的高效性和可扩展性。系统功能主要包括学生信息管理、宿舍分配与调整、费用缴纳记录、维修申请处理等模块,支持多角色登录(如管理员、学生、宿管人员),并实现数据可视化展示。系统采用RESTful API设计规范,前后端分离,保障代码的可维护性和安全性。关键词:多角色权限、RESTful API、数据可视化、Vue3、MyBatis-Plus。
数据表
学生住宿信息表:存储学生基本信息和住宿状态,学号作为主键,关联宿舍分配和费用缴纳记录,结构表如表1所示。
| 字段名 | 数据类型 | 描述 |
|---|---|---|
| student_id | VARCHAR(20) | 学号(主键) |
| student_name | VARCHAR(50) | 学生姓名 |
| gender | CHAR(1) | 性别(M/F) |
| college | VARCHAR(100) | 所属学院 |
| major | VARCHAR(100) | 专业 |
| phone | VARCHAR(15) | 联系电话 |
| dorm_id | VARCHAR(10) | 宿舍编号(外键) |
| check_in_date | DATE | 入住日期 |
| status | TINYINT | 住宿状态(0退宿/1在住) |
宿舍资源表:记录宿舍楼栋和房间信息,宿舍编号为主键,用于分配和查询可用床位,结构表如表2所示。
| 字段名 | 数据类型 | 描述 |
|---|---|---|
| dorm_id | VARCHAR(10) | 宿舍编号(主键) |
| building_name | VARCHAR(50) | 楼栋名称 |
| room_number | VARCHAR(10) | 房间号 |
| bed_capacity | INT | 床位总数 |
| occupied_beds | INT | 已占用床位 |
| floor | TINYINT | 所在楼层 |
| dorm_type | VARCHAR(20) | 宿舍类型(如4人间) |
维修申请记录表:管理学生提交的维修请求,申请编号为主键,关联学生和宿舍信息,结构表如表3所示。
| 字段名 | 数据类型 | 描述 |
|---|---|---|
| repair_id | BIGINT | 维修单号(主键) |
| student_id | VARCHAR(20) | 申请人学号(外键) |
| dorm_id | VARCHAR(10) | 宿舍编号(外键) |
| repair_content | VARCHAR(255) | 维修内容 |
| submit_time | DATETIME | 提交时间 |
| status | TINYINT | 处理状态(0未处理/1完成) |
| handler | VARCHAR(50) | 处理人员 |
| finish_time | DATETIME | 完成时间 |
博主介绍:
🎓简介: 软件工程专业毕业 | 优快云 博客达人 | 全栈项目开发实践
参与过多个企业级软件项目的设计与开发,熟悉从需求分析、架构设计到编码测试的全流程。现在创建计算机毕设工作室团队,专注 Java
全栈项目、Python 实用工具软件、Web
管理系统开发,涵盖电商、教育、办公等多个课题的计算机毕设开发、定制、远程、文档编写指导。各类软件项目 30 + 个,累计售出 1000 +
套。🎯 核心服务:提供自主开发的各类软件项目源码及部署服务,包括电商平台、在线教育系统、企业办公
OA、数据分析等。项目均包含完整文档、演示案例和技术支持,可满足学习研究、二次开发或商用的不同需求。

系统介绍:
Java Web web宿舍管理系统系统源码-SpringBoot2+Vue3+MyBatis-Plus+MySQL8.0【含文档】,拿走直接用(附源码,数据库,视频,可提供说明文档(通过AIGC)技术包括:MySQL、VueJS、ElementUI、(Python或者Java或者.NET)等等功能如图所示。可以滴我获取详细的视频介绍
功能参考截图:





系统架构参考:

视频演示:
请dd我获取更详细的演示视频 或者直接加我,网名和签名就是联系方式
项目案例参考:
3604

被折叠的 条评论
为什么被折叠?



